DieHardKingsFan wrote:Monta Ellis is a baller...plain and simple. Sure, it's easy to point out that he's undersized, but at 6'3" the guy is a stud. He's in his prime right now (27 going on 28 this year), has familiarity with our new coach, and has mutual interest to play for our team and owner (who already loves his game). NBA.com lists Monta on their "HOT LIST: TOP 10 UNRESTRICTED FREE AGENTS." http://hangtime.blogs.nba.com/2013/05/09/hot-list-top-10-unrestricted-free-agents/?ls=nbahpfull And, it's always worth considering a proven guy like him.
I know a lot of fans would love to see Tyreke return, so why not he and Monta play together in the backcourt? Obviously, Tyreke would have to go back to playing point, though. This pairing could at least solve the whole undersized argument because Tyreke can guard the 2 position while Monta is quick enough to guard the PGs of the league like Derrick Rose or Russell Westbrook. The obvious drawback to this kind of move would be our flexibility (cap room) going forward. Of course, everything is still predicated on what we do in the draft. Keep/trade Cousins for picks? Etc. However, with all that said, I still like Oladipo w/ the #7 pick...especially if we lose Tyreke.
I'm not saying Ellis is the answer for our woeful team, but I think he does deserve more consideration because he can be of some help and at most a slight hindrance. But, for all we know, Ellis may just be using/leveraging the Kings as a means to getting a bigger contract out of the Bucks.
